Here’s the guy running the Arizona Legislature, Russell Pearce, on immigration
Here’s the guy running the Arizona Legislature, Russell Pearce, the one who made sure his Republican peanut gallery got SB 1070 passed, speaking in September 2006:




“We know what we need to do. In 1953, Dwight D. Eisenhower put together a task force called ‘Operation Wetback.’ He removed, in less than a year, 1.3 million illegal aliens. They must be deported.”


“In the ‘50s it was common. In the ‘60s it was common. You don’t use it today because people have tried to make it offensive. Things change, and you know what? Who cares? Whatever they want to be called, I’m OK with that.”
